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Warsaw, the capital city of Poland, is a vibrant metropolis that seamlessly blends rich history with modernity. Located in the heart of Europe, Warsaw is not only the political and economic center of Poland but also a cultural hub teeming with life. From its resilient history marked by wartime destruction and miraculous rebirth to its thriving arts scene, Warsaw offers a unique experience to both residents and visitors. The city is known for its architectural diversity, featuring everything from Gothic churches and neoclassical palaces to contemporary skyscrapers. Warsaw's Old Town, meticulously rebuilt after World War II, is a UNESCO World Heritage Site that stands as a testament to the city's indomitable spirit. Alongside these historic sites, Warsaw is home to cutting-edge museums, bustling markets, and lush green parks. Warsaw’s dynamic atmosphere is also reflected in its culinary scene, where traditional Polish dishes are served alongside international cuisines in a myriad of restaurants and street food markets. The city’s extensive public transport network makes it easy to explore, and its calendar is filled with cultural festivals, music concerts, and art exhibitions that cater to diverse tastes. In essence, Warsaw is a city that honors its past while embracing the future, offering a rich tapestry of experiences for anyone who walks its streets. Whether you're interested in history, culture, or simply soaking in the urban vibe, Warsaw has something to offer everyone.
